          Mica Ertegun

          American interior designer (1926–2023)

          Mica Ertegun was a Romanian-American interior designer and philanthropist.

          Early life

          Mica Ertegun, born Ioana Maria Banu on October 21, 1926, in Bucharest, Romania, was the only child of Natalia Gologan and Gheorghe Banu, a prominent figure in King Carol II’s cabinet and an ally of King Michael I during World War II.

          Amid Allied air raids, Mica was sent to the family’s country estate. Following the 1948 abdication of King Michael and her father's imprisonment by the Communist regime, Mica and her husband, Stefan Grecianu, an aristocrat 15 years older, fled Romania, traveling via stateless refugee passports to Zurich.

          Initially penniless, they were supported by friends, staying at the Dolder Grand hotel and later moving to Paris, where Mica worked as a model. Eventually, they relocated to Canada, where Mica spent eight years working on a farm.[1]
